P1-3 Munlochy Primary Multisports

We had our first session yesterday afternoon of after school Multisports. A very fun and engaging session following an Animal theme. Lots of laughter!

A big thank you to our new volunteers who have come forward to deliver this.

Lots of sport happening at Munlochy Primary School over the last few weeks. The P7s all had Junior Leader Training in the winter. Now they are busy delivering at Lunchtimes with various different clubs.

We have:
- Athletics club πŸƒβ€β™‚οΈ πŸƒβ€β™€οΈ
- Football club ⚽️
- Dance and karaoke club πŸ•Ί πŸ’ƒ 🎀

We also have Mrs Marwick back doing some after school Orienteering.

A big thanks to Mrs Irvine for supporting her pupils in their delivery.

Netball Club at Avoch Primary School.

Yesterday afternoon saw the start of a 4 week block of after school Netball. The group started off with some passing drills then looked at player positions on the court and rules of the game. Next week, they will build on this and practice shooting and build that back into the game. Thank you Mrs Callander for your time and knowledge.
